This is an excellent opportunity to join Tesla as the Construction Intern, providing critical support to our dynamic team whilst learning a wide range of skills across Facilities, Real Estate, Design and Construction.
In this fast-paced position, you will be responsible for general administrative duties and daily processing of administrative tasks to support the Construction team. You will work in a cross functional role coordinating construction activities, assisting the project manager with schedule, budget, and ensuring deliverable dates are met. In addition, you will be involved in assisting with various critical tasks and projects when required across Real Estate, Design & Facilities.
